Connecting devices that are not designed for phantom power when phantom power is enabled for
the two XLR ports can seriously damage those devices. Always check the phantom power LED
before connecting devices to the XLR ports.
To choose a different audio device for the channel:
1. Using a web browser on the admin computer, go to the IP address of your Pearl Mini and log in, see
Connect to the Admin panel
.
2. From the Channels menu, select your channel (i.e. HDMI-A or HDMI-B) and click Layouts. The custom
channel layout editor page opens.
3. Check the audio source that you want to use for the layout and click Save.
